Students from less well-off families are, on average, 2.6× more likely to work to afford studying than those from very well-off backgrounds.

The gap is huge in some countries:
🇩🇪 Germany: 9.3×
🇷🇴 Romania: 5.8×
🇭🇷 Croatia: 5.2×
🇨🇿 The Czech Republic: 5.1×

Students’ self-earned income is the single most important source of income in 54% of the #EUROSTUDENT countries. This is true for the 🇨🇿 Czech Republic, 🇨🇭 Switzerland, 🇩🇪 Germany, 🇵🇱 Poland, 🇭🇺 Hungary, 🇮🇪 Ireland, 🇳🇱 the Netherlands, 🇲🇹 Malta, 🇪🇪 Estonia, 🇦🇹 Austria, 🇮🇸 Iceland, 🇫🇮 Finland & 🇳🇴 Norway.

Across EUROSTUDENT countries, 26% of students face an accommodation cost overburden.
International students report it even more often than domestic ones. The burden is also heavier for those relying on public student support. Also, students w. financial difficulties are far more likely to struggle.

When looking at students' time budget, 🇱🇻 Latvian and 🇵🇱 Polish students top the charts, spending 54 hours/week on study & work — compared to just 41 hours in 🇫🇷 France. On average, part-time students clock 10 more hours weekly than full-timers, mostly due to working nearly 3× as much (32h vs 11h).

Older students = happier students?
According to the EUROSTUDENT 8 data, students aged 30+ report the highest well-being scores (avg. 56 points) vs. 50 points for younger peers.
